How Reliable is the Nissan Qx?

Based on 6,130 MOT tests across 868 vehicles.

67.6%
Pass Rate
5,176
Miles/Year
31
Year Lifespan
868
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

constant velocity joint gaiter split 537
Brake pipe excessively corroded 380
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 336
Stop lamp not working 208
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 200

WIL 2435 is a 1996 Nissan Qx in Blue with a 1,995c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 1 MOT test with a personal pass rate of 100%.

Across all 1996 Nissan Qx models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.1% with a typical mileage of 105,880 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Nissan Qx fails its MOT is constant velocity joint gaiter split, accounting for 537 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WIL 2435,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Qx typ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 30 years old, this Nissan Qx is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
